Reproduction of Gifts from the Meadow I by Sarah Adams

Sarah Adams — "Gifts from the Meadow I" presents a contemporary meditation on the botanical tradition, rendered with a refined minimalism that echoes the precision of historical botanical illustration while transcending its didactic roots. The composition, characterized by an asymmetric balance and a sparse distribution of forms, aligns with the principles of modernist abstraction, where the essence of the subject is distilled into essential lines and negative space. Adams employs a monochromatic palette dominated by warm grays and cream, a technique that evokes the tactile quality of aged paper and the subtle tonal variations found in natural light, creating a sense of timelessness. The work’s visual structure, with its deliberate use of negative space and a central horizontal axis, invites contemplation, allowing the viewer’s gaze to wander between the forms and the void. This approach situates the piece within the lineage of 20th-century modernist botanical art, where artists like Georgia O’Keeffe and contemporary practitioners reimagined flora not as mere specimens but as abstracted symbols of life and growth. The result is a work of quiet sophistication, where the interplay of line, light, and space conveys a profound sense of harmony and balance, reflecting a deep engagement with both nature and the aesthetics of minimalism.
